What this shows Airports here range from 81.4% to 86.4% on-time.
| Code | Airport | City | Flights | On-Time | Avg Delay (when late)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| LIT | Little Rock, AR | Little Rock | 133,985 | 81.4% | 73.7 min |
| XNA | Fayetteville, AR | Fayetteville | 130,348 | 83.2% | 78.1 min |
| FSM | Fort Smith, AR | Fort Smith | 14,933 | 85.8% | 84.8 min |
| TXK | Texarkana, AR | Texarkana | 10,935 | 86.4% | 92.6 min |

Read the analysis →What the Data Says About Flying in Arkansas
Arkansas (AR) has 4 airports tracked in the Bureau of Transportation Statistics on-time performance dataset, which together handled 290,201 flights. Across those flights, the statewide on-time rate comes in at 82.6%, with 3,324 cancellations producing a 1.15% cancellation rate. The average delay when a flight runs late is 76.6 minutes. Together these numbers are the most useful summary of what air travel through Arkansas airports looks like in aggregate, and they provide the baseline for comparing individual airports against each other and against national averages.
The busiest airport in Arkansas is Little Rock, AR (LIT) in Little Rock, which handled 133,985 flights at a 81.4% on-time rate and an average delay of 73.7 minutes. On the reliability front, Texarkana, AR (TXK) posts the highest on-time rate at 86.4% across 10,935 flights, worth comparing if you have flexibility on origin or destination airport within Arkansas. Performance can differ sharply between a state's biggest hub and its smaller airports, so airport-level pages are the right place to dig into specifics.
Why the spread? Delays in Arkansas - as everywhere in the BTS dataset, break down into five categories: late-arriving aircraft, carrier issues like maintenance and crew, National Aviation System constraints such as air traffic control and airspace congestion, weather, and security. The relative mix changes by airport and season: a small regional airport may see weather dominate, while a major hub tends to lean on late-aircraft and NAS delays. For travelers choosing flights through Arkansas, the combination of a 82.6% statewide on-time rate, 76.6-minute average delay when late, and 1.15% cancellation rate is the concrete benchmark to weigh against specific airports and carriers.
